Tips on Choosing a Good Commercial Sign

Blog

In today's world, the majority of businesses rely on commercial signs to attract customers. A great sign is not just a perfect way to announce your business to potential clients, it's often regarded as the first impression that clients have about your business. Therefore, it's critical to pick a commercial sign that can reflect the positive attributes of your business.

1. Keep the Message Clear and Simple

The message on your commercial sign needs to be both easy to read and straightforward. The content should have a concise and clear message about the services your business provides. Make sure you choose a font style and size that is easy to read from a distance. Keep the message short and sweet since most people won't have the time to read a lengthy advertisement.

2. Use High-Quality Materials

The materials used in making your commercial sign should be of high quality so it can last for a long time without fading or getting damaged. The sign material, lighting, and printing quality will impact how long-lasting your sign will be. LED lights are usually the best for commercial signs as they offer high visibility at night.

3. Choose the Right Colors

The color choices you make when designing your commercial sign matter significantly. It's best to choose colors that represent your brand to help enhance brand recognition among potential customers. Your choice of colors can affect the attractiveness and effectiveness of your commercial sign in a positive or negative way. Bright and bold colors are ideal for attracting attention, while muted colors are more dignified.

4. Check Local Zoning Regulations

Before designing your commercial sign, ensure you are familiar with your local zoning rules. Every business district has zoning regulations that dictate the size, location, and design of commercial signs. These rules ensure that signs are placed in the right areas to avoid distractions and traffic accidents. You don't want to spend money on a sign only to find out later that it violates a zoning law.
